Ribbed and columnar, a saguaro usually develops five or six branches at a height of about 5 metres (16 feet). Slow growing at first—it reaches only 2 cm (less than 1 inch) in height during its first 10 years—it grows approximately 10 cm (4 inches) a year after attaining a height of 2 to 3 metres (about 6.5 …The Saguaro Cactus is Arizona's state flower. The average lifespan for a Saguaro cactus is about 200 years. The Saguaro Cactus lives in an especially rocky terrain consisting of desert slopes and flats. In Saguaro National Park, studies indicate that a saguaro grows between 1 and 1.5 inches in the first eight years of its life. These tiny, young saguaros are very hard to find as they grow under the protection of a "nurse tree", most often a palo verde, ironwood or mesquite tree. Size & Quantity. $ 7.00. Add to cart. Cacti expand by absorbing water when it is available and shrink as they lose water slowly during times of drought. The saguaro cactus flowers every year and can have up to 200 blooms. It can withstand high temperatures, but cannot survive temperatures below ...Saguaros produce flowers in a radial pattern around their stems, starting from the east and moving counterclockwise. This is the first documented case of asynchronous flowering in …Methods: In this study we looked at the flowering phenology of a keystone species in the Sonoran Desert, the saguaro cactus (Carnegiea gigantea). The timing and abundance of flowering was observed on 151 individuals for 10 years at a site near Tucson, Arizona, USA. While the Saguaro’s blossoms are not unique in color, creamy white, or size, 3 inches in diameter, the age at which a Saguaro first blooms is unique. The Saguaro does not experience its first bloom until roughly 35-50 years of age. The saguaro produces fruit and flower blossoms. The saguaro blossom is the official state flower of Arizona. The cactus blooms in the springtime with beautiful flowers on the tops of its spear and arms, accompanying the wildflowers that pop up in the Sonoran Desert every spring. Saguaro cactus forest in Saguaro National Park Arizona. Cactus Tree Isolated on Pure White Background (XXXL) Saguaro are very slow growing cactus. A 10 year old plant might only be 1.5 inches tall. Saguaro can grow to be between 40-60 feet tall (12-18m). When rain is plentiful and the saguaro is fully hydrated it can weigh between 3200-4800 pounds. Quick Facts The saguaro is the largest cactus in the United States.
